u/Dampfexpress Jul 25 '26

Yes. I highly recommend it. It mostly contains findings from the nearby "Dürrnberg" and its waaaayy less overrun than Hallstatt.

u/Dampfexpress Jul 26 '26

If you have a car and some time while you are down there, i also recommend you driving a bit further south to the Golling Waterfall. Its beautiful and worth the drive. Austrian historian Georg Rohrecker also called it a "holy place" of the hallstatt / Dürrnberg celts (not backed up by archeology as far as im aware).
